Fioricet and Vomiting aggravated - a phase IV clinical study of FDA data
Summary:
Vomiting aggravated is reported as a side effect among people who take Fioricet (acetaminophen; butalbital; caffeine), especially for people who are female, 50-59 old, have been taking the drug for 1 - 6 months also take Zofran, and have Pain.
The phase IV clinical study analyzes which people have Vomiting aggravated when taking Fioricet. It is created by eHealthMe based on reports of 11,479 people who have side effects when taking Fioricet from the FDA, and is updated regularly.

11,479 people reported to have side effects when taking Fioricet.
Among them, 599 people (5.22%) have Vomiting aggravated.

How the study uses the data?
The study uses data from the FDA. It is based on acetaminophen; butalbital; caffeine (the active ingredients of Fioricet) and Fioricet (the brand name). Other drugs that have the same active ingredients (e.g. generic drugs) are not considered. Dosage of drugs is not considered in the study.
